I have real struggles trying to get text to properly wrap around the bottom of a circular logo.
Seems no matter what I do some of the text is always out of whack - the e highter than the letter next to it, the m cut off..
Any suggestions on how to handle this?

There is a known problem with the smaller fonts not being about to resized to a small scale without becoming distorted. LB is working on the issue, but no time line as of now on a fix. Tricks are just to play with different fonts until you find one that works better or use a secondary editing program to use the font you want and create the shape you need and import that into TLC for final logo creation.

the other work around, is a bit more tedious. You can type each letter at a time and then kern each letter giving it a circular look.
